A Glimpse into the Tobacco Empire
Founded by R.J. Reynolds in 1875, the company began as a small tobacco shop in downtown Winston-Salem, North Carolina. Through strategic partnerships, aggressive marketing, and innovative product development, Reynolds Tobacco quickly expanded its reach and became one of the largest tobacco manufacturers in the United States.
Today, R.J. Reynolds Tobacco Company is part of the Reynolds American Inc. and operates as one of the leading tobacco companies globally, with a diverse portfolio of cigarette brands across the world.

Navigating the Complexities of the Tobacco Industry
Throughout its history, R.J. Reynolds has had to navigate the complex and ever-changing regulatory landscape surrounding the tobacco industry. From the Surgeon General’s warning labels in the 1960s to the current efforts to promote smoke-free living, the company has adapted and responded to the evolving needs of consumers, regulators, and the market.
As governments worldwide have implemented stringent anti-smoking laws and policies, R.J. Reynolds has focused on developing alternative products such as heating tobacco products, e-cigarettes, and harm reduction products to address the changing attitudes towards tobacco consumption.
